Letter: Urging your support for Rep. Steve Handy

Sep 23, 2022

I support the write-in candidate Representative Steve Handy (R), 16th House District, who represents portions of Layton, Clearfield and South Weber. He has served this district since 2010, lived in Layton for 44 years, and served two terms on the Layton City Council. He has improved transportation and infrastructure, widened educational and human services opportunities, and addressed important environmental issues such as clean air quality and the survival of the Great Salt Lake. He is a Conservative, working to lower taxes, protect gun ownership and unborn life, and curb inflation.

Republican caucuses this spring were poorly attended in District 16. At the Davis County GOP Convention only 99 delegates represented the 11,773 registered Republicans in the district. Of those, 59 voted to nominate a candidate other than Steve Handy in the upcoming elections. This is just 0.005 percent of Republicans in House District 16! Those convention delegates chose to turn aside a proven winner for an untested model.

This “untested model” is newcomer Trevor Lee. He has offered vague generalities about his political philosophy and goals but very specific and inaccurate views of Handy’s legislative record. He embarrassed himself with his own party. Lee used a disparaging term for transgender athletes, earning him a strong rebuke from the Davis County Republican Committee who condemned his “transphobic comments.”

I urge House District 16 voters of any party to write in the full name, “Steve Handy,” in the space allotted on this year’s Davis County ballot. Ensure Representative Handy continues his service to the residents of east Layton, Clearfield and South Weber.
